What is Pentopra used for?

Pentopra is used for the treatment of peptic ulcer disease, reflux esophagitis or g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D). Pentopra prevents acidity associated with use of painkillers. It is also used to treat a disease associated with excessive acid production in the stomach known as Zollinger Ellison syndrome (ZES). It works by reducing the amount of acid made by your stomach and thus relieves your symptoms.

What are the long term side effects of Pentopra?

If Pentopra is used for more than 3 months, certain long term side effects may be seen. The most important of these is low magnesium levels in your blood which may make you feel tired, confused, dizzy, shaky or dizzy. You may also have muscle twitches or irregular heartbeat. If the use is further prolonged for more than a year, you may have an increased risk of bone fractures, stomach infections and vitamin B12 deficiency. Vitamin B12 deficiency can make you anemic, as a result of which you may feel more tired, weak, or pale. Additionally you may have palpitations, shortness of breath, lightheadedness, indigestion, loss of appetite, flatulence (gas) or nerve problems such as numbness, tingling and problem in walking.

Can I stop taking Cipromed TZ when I feel better?

It is crucial that you continue taking Cipromed TZ and finish the entire prescribed course of treatment even if you start to feel better Although your symptoms may improve it does not necessarily mean that the infection has been completely eradicated Discontinuing the medication prematurely can allow the bacteria to multiply and develop resistance to the antibiotic potentially leading to a recurrence or more severe infection By adhering to the full treatment regimen you are ensuring the best chance for a successful outcome and minimizing the risk of complications Remember the prescribed duration of treatment is designed to target and eliminate the infection thoroughly If you have concerns or experience any unexpected side effects consult your healthcare provider for guidance It is always better to follow professional medical advice and complete the prescribed course of antibiotics Your dedication to completing the treatment will contribute to your overall health and wellbeing
